johnwickenden's review of Coomes Way

Vistied 13 Jan 2018 to see Wick v St Francis Rangers in the Southern Combination League Division 1. The ground is located in Coomes Way but is called Crabtree Park and Wick were, until two seasons ago, called Wick and Barnham United.

Location

Wick is a village on the northern outskirts of Littlehampton. The ground is in Coomes Lane which about 200 yards north of the A259 / A284 roundabout. The road is on the right just before the level crossing. Nearest station is Littlehampton which is easily 20 mins walk and, whilst there is a car park on site, this only holds about 50 cars and a lot of spaces gets taken up by club officials and players. There is street parking nearby. The nearest pub is the Locomotive by the level crossing although about a mile to the north in Lyminster is the Six Bells

View

County League division 1...don't expect too much. Turnstiles are behind the goal with the main stand ahead as you enter the ground. This looks about 40 years old and is of corrugated metal construction. It contains about 50 seats, none of which have backs. The only other cover is a small covered area on the other side of the pitch near the dugouts. There is a hard path surrounding the rest of the pitch.

Facilities

The clubhouse is built to match the rest of the houses in Coome Way...it looks like a house ! Toilets are on the ground floor and a clean and tidy. There is no club shop and nor do they sell any club merchandise from the bar upstairs. The programme is poorly finished with a single staple but it actually contains a fair bit of info on the team and the Southern Combination league. Good value for £1.

Food & Drink

There is a bar upstairs in the clubhouse and a tea bar / hatch outside. There was no price list displayed so I have no idea what hot food they offer. I do know they sell soft drinks, tea / coffee etc, crisps and chocolate bars

Atmosphere

There isn't any. The average crowd this season has been 38. Apart from the odd shout of "Come on Wickers!" (and I thought they were talking to me) the loudest noise was the opposition captain
